@Heard Island and McDonald Islands, People

Population: uninhabited

@Heard Island and McDonald Islands, Government

Names: conventional long form: Territory of Heard Island and McDonald Islands conventional short form: Heard Island and McDonald Islands Digraph: HM Type: territory of Australia administered by the Ministry for Environment, Sport, and Territories Capital: none; administered from Canberra, Australia Independence: none (territory of Australia)

@Heard Island and McDonald Islands, Economy

Overview: no economic activity

@Heard Island and McDonald Islands, Communications

Ports: none; offshore anchorage only

@Heard Island and McDonald Islands, Defense Forces

Note: defense is the responsibility of Australia
